JAVA实现的医院管理系统课程设计

版权申诉
0 下载量 102 浏览量 更新于2024-06-28 收藏 1.22MB PDF 举报
"JAVA-医院管理系统课程设计.pdf" 这篇文档详细介绍了使用JAVA进行医院管理系统课程设计的相关内容,旨在通过实际项目加深学生对JAVA语言的理解,特别是面向对象编程的概念和技巧。这个系统设计的目标是构建一个现代化的医院管理平台,以适应科技发展对医疗服务提出的更高要求。 1. **课程设计目的**: - 该课程设计的目标是让学生运用面向对象的开发方法,这是一种当前广泛使用的编程方式,其特点是语义贴近自然,有助于软件的维护和扩展。 - 通过设计医院管理系统,学生能够实践JAVA语言的关键概念,特别是面向对象特性,增强他们解决实际问题的能力。 - 课程设计的目的是使学生能将所学的JAVA语言知识与其他相关课程内容相结合,全面掌握JAVA编程思想和面向对象程序设计。 2. **设计方案论证**: - 开发环境:使用JAVA开发工具JDK,并在Windows 7操作系统上运行。 - 系统功能:主要包括医生信息管理(如基本信息、职称、岗位、工资等)、人事调动管理,以及病人信息、病床、药剂和仪器的管理,还包括用户管理和权限控制。 - 功能模块设计:通过系统功能模块图(图1未显示)来组织和规划各个功能部分。 - 数据库需求分析:强调了数据库结构设计的重要性,良好的设计能提高效率,确保数据完整性和一致性,提升响应速度,简化应用程序实现。 3. **数据库需求分析**: - 数据库需求分析是设计的第一步,包括收集基本数据、定义数据结构和确定数据处理流程,形成详细的数据字典,为后续设计奠定基础。 - 数据关系分析(图2未显示)是根据医院管理的实际需求,确定系统将处理的数据实体之间的关联。 综上,这个课程设计项目提供了一个实践平台,让学生能够综合运用JAVA技术和面向对象设计原则,设计出一个实用的医院管理系统。同时,它也强调了数据库设计在系统中的核心地位,以及理解用户需求的重要性。通过这样的项目,学生可以提升自己的技能,为未来的学习和职业生涯做好准备。